The deadly attack on MIM MLA Akbaruddin Owaisi is still fresh in the minds of people. Even as the legislator's health condition is improving in the hospital, some miscreants are trying to flare up passions in old city areas since Monday night. According to police sources, the posters containing a cluster of pictures where Akbaruddin was shown in different postures after receiving gunshot and dagger wounds first appeared in Darul Shifa area and on Tuesday at numerous other localities from Charminar and Malakpet to Karwan and Asifnagar assembly segments, which the police removed promptly apprehending clashes.
The police officials say that this is the second such instance where the MIM supporters have gone on the offensive. Last week, the MIM channel 4TV aired select footage of the attack on Akbaruddin. The related CD showing an already wounded Akbaruddin being stabbed by a person has been seized and its telecsast was stopped because it could have led to attacks on the alleged assailants and their families. However, the police have neither registered any case in regard to posters nor arrested anybody. "We have identified some people responsible for the mischief. Suitable action would be initiated against them soon," the police said.
